Sandra I lost a lot of weight before my dx and during chemo had to force myself to eat a small bowl of cereal for breakfast, a mandarin orange for lunch and half a ham sandwich for dinner!!! I know its not much and I didn't even want that but forced it down and it kept me alive and well enough to continue my treatments. I lost a lot of weight but gained it back about a year after my chemo finished, my Onc told me to just eat what I could and felt like during treatment and there would be time enough to eat healthily once I was well again and he was right as I need to lose half a stone right now!!
I also enjoyed some home made soups but little and often is the key I think.

i had a horrible time with food during FEC - nothing was appealing at all. I would drink those meal replacement drinks and i found that they would help a lot. I would drink one as soon as i got up or else i felt faint. The cancer ctr where i was treated suggested them.
In between i ate whatever i could tolerate - lots of oatmeal (which to this day i can't look at) Tricia is absolutely right...eat whatever appeals to you, you can go back to healthy eating after
I dropped 12 lbs on chemo and have gained it all back

My onc also told me to eat whatever I wanted just to maintain some weight even burgers and milkshakes! But my appetite was poor . Ensure drinks were very helpful. Maybe blended with a banana into a smoothie ice cream. Yogurt. Cheese and crackers. Soups. Small frequent snacks. Important to stay hydrated.
